What is the definition of addition in math?

Addition is the mathematical process ofputting things together. The plus sign "+" means thatnumbers are added together. It is commutative, meaning thatorder does not matter, and it is associative, meaning thatone can add more than two numbers.

Also question is, how do you define addition?

Addition (usually signified by the plus symbol"+") is one of the four basic operations of arithmetic; the othersare subtraction, multiplication and division. The additionof two whole numbers is the total amount of those valuescombined.

Also Know, what is Mathematics in simple words? Mathematics is the study of numbers, shapes andpatterns. The word comes from the Greek word"μάθημα" (máthema), meaning"science, knowledge, or learning", and is sometimes shortened tomaths (in England, Australia, Ireland, and New Zealand) ormath (in the United States and Canada).

The Basic Operations

Symbol Words Used
+ Addition, Add, Sum, Plus, Increase, Total
Subtraction, Subtract, Minus, Less, Difference, Decrease, TakeAway, Deduct
× Multiplication, Multiply, Product, By, Times, Lots Of
÷ Division, Divide, Quotient, Goes Into, How Many Times

What is the sum of an addition problem?

In mathematics, sum can be defined as the resultor answer we get on adding two or more numbers or terms. Here, forexample, addends 8 and 5 add up to make the sum 13. Thesum of the opposite sides of a die is alwaysseven.

What is addition problem?

Setting Up the Problem It tells you to add the value before the sign to thevalue after the sign. The two values in an addition problemare called "addends" and the answer is called the "sum." You willalso see two different layouts of additionproblems.

What comes first multiplication or addition?

After multiplication and division has beencompleted, add or subtract in order from left to right. The orderof addition and subtraction is also determined by which onecomes first when reading from left to right.

What is the nature of math?

The Nature of Mathematics. Now much more thanarithmetic and geometry, mathematics today is a diversediscipline that deals with data, measurements, and observationsfrom science; with inference, deduction, and proof; and withmathematical models of natural phenomena, of humanbehavior, and of social systems.
